Sail Date: Feb 2011

We sailed on this ship in November, 2010, on the classic itinerary..liked those islands much better.

This was a good cruise...getting on the ship in San Juan took all of 20 minutes and we were finished at 1:30pm..had all day to relax, unpack and enjoy the ship.

Had a mini suite ( same as last time)...this cabin is starting to show some wear and tear...had some trouble with the commode flushing, but not an issue. Had a great cabin steward ( Olimpio )..very cheerful and accommodating, always had extra ice and fresh beach towels.

Cabin Review

Cabin AA

Cabin D528

Port side cabin...no noise, good location for elevator access, nice sized balcony

Little bit of wear and tear on the carpet....starting to show its age.

Great mini suite..has two tv's ( why you need two tx's, I will never know )

nice sofa,,,bed was very comfortable.

Had extra pillows provided by request.

Refrig is not very cold...room was nice and cool. Last tiem we were on D501, same ship, and the cabin was always hot.

We were pleased with the cabin and our steward ( Olimpio)
